Most of the time it is difficult to pick a Mustang swimmer of the meet because we usually have plenty who step up to the challenge. At this past short course TAGS (Texas Age Group Swimming Championships), which took place in early March, the decision was easy….Karolina Valko. Karolina won all seven of her individual events and helped her teammates (Simone Edwards, Christine Salmassian and Jordan Arbuckle) win two of the 11-12 girls relays. That feat is rarely accomplished at a swim meet, let alone a state championship. Congratulations Karolina and to all the Mustangs who competed at TAGS!

Our Sectionals team traveled to Texas A&M in College Station to compete with over 80 teams at this year’s USA Sectionals Championships. Most of our swimmers were coming off successful high school championships and did a good job of refocusing for this meet. The Mustangs finished eleventh over all and our top performer was Amie Perna, who finished second in the 100 back and scoring 39 points in her individual events.
